The Jatco RL4F01A 4-speed automatic transmission was produced only from 1982 to 1988 and was found only on American versions of the Prairie, known as the Multi and Stanza Wagon. It is considered the “little brother” of the RL4F02A and is rated for 160 Nm of torque.
Specifications
| Type | automatic transmission |
| Number of gears | 4 |
| Type of drive | front/all wheel |
| Engine volume, l | up to 2.0 |
| Torque output, Nm | up to 160 |
| Recommended oil | Nissan AT-Matic D Fluid |
| Oil capacity, liter | 5.7 |
| Replacing the oil | every 55 000 km |
| Replacing the filter | every 55 000 km |
| Gearbox lifespan, km | ~220 000 km |
Gear ratios Jatco RL4F01A
Using the example of a 1985 Nissan Stanza Wagon with a 2.0-liter engine:
| Main | 3.88 |
| 1st | 2.78 |
| 2nd | 1.54 |
| 3rd | 1.00 |
| 4th | 0.69 |
| Reverse | 2.27 |

Disadvantages of the Jatco RL4F01A gearbox
- With regular oil changes, the transmission can last hundreds of thousands of kilometers;
- The most common replacements in this automatic transmission are the solenoids and dried-out rubber gaskets;
- There are reports online of bushings turning due to prolonged oil starvation.
